MirrorProxy is a self-hosted Rust mirror-proxy platform with three independently evolving parts:
-
mirrorproxy-server: proxy service, SQLite database, and embedded React console. -
mirrorproxy: standalone Windows, macOS, and Linux source-management CLI. -
mirrorproxy-catalog: shared target, route, and local-configuration catalog.
It provides one controlled endpoint for GitHub, OCI, language registries, toolchains, and operating-system repositories. The console adds users and quotas, source health, audit logs, offline GeoIP reporting, IP/CIDR allow/deny rules, and ACME certificate management. GeoIP lookups stay in local XDB files.
| Situation | Recommended mode |
|---|---|
| Existing Caddy/Nginx/Traefik | Keep TLS at the reverse proxy and bind MirrorProxy internally. |
| Single host without a reverse proxy | Enable ACME direct_https; MirrorProxy binds 80/443 and redirects HTTP to HTTPS. |
| Ordinary hostnames | Use HTTP-01; public port 80 must reach MirrorProxy. |
| Wildcard certificates | Use DNS-01; Cloudflare, Aliyun, DNSPod, Route53, and webhook are supported. |
